Why Excel Skills Are Important Today

Almost every industry uses Excel in some form.

From small businesses to multinational companies, Excel is widely used because it helps organize and analyze information efficiently.

Companies use Excel for:

  • Managing employee records
  • Creating reports
  • Tracking sales
  • Budget planning
  • Data analysis
  • Inventory management
  • Financial calculations

Because of its versatility, employers prefer candidates who already know Excel.


Excel Skills Increase Job Opportunities

One of the biggest advantages of learning Excel is that it opens doors to multiple job opportunities.

Excel is required in fields such as:

  • Finance
  • Banking
  • Accounting
  • Marketing
  • Data entry
  • Human Resources
  • Sales
  • Operations
  • Business analytics

Even government and private sector jobs often require basic or advanced Excel knowledge.

Candidates with Excel skills have an advantage over those who do not know the software.


Excel Skills Improve Your Resume

Recruiters often receive hundreds of resumes for a single job opening.

Having Excel skills on your resume can help you stand out.

When employers see:

  • VLOOKUP
  • Pivot Tables
  • Data Analysis
  • Charts & Graphs
  • Formulas & Functions

they understand that you can handle business data efficiently.

Excel skills make your resume look more professional and job-ready.

Excel Skills Help in Data Analysis

Data is extremely important in modern businesses.

Companies make decisions based on reports and data analysis.

Excel helps professionals:

  • Analyze sales trends
  • Compare performance
  • Create visual reports
  • Identify patterns
  • Track business growth

Advanced Excel tools such as:

  • Pivot Tables
  • Charts
  • Dashboards
  • Lookup formulas

make data analysis easier and faster.

This is why Excel is considered one of the most valuable business tools.


Excel Is Useful in Almost Every Profession

One of the best things about Excel is that it is useful in nearly every career field.

Students

Excel helps students:

  • Organize study schedules
  • Create projects
  • Analyze academic data

Accountants

Excel is used for:

  • Financial statements
  • Tax calculations
  • Budgeting

HR Professionals

HR departments use Excel for:

  • Employee records
  • Attendance tracking
  • Payroll management

Sales & Marketing

Excel helps in:

  • Sales reporting
  • Performance tracking
  • Customer database management

Business Owners

Small business owners use Excel for:

  • Expense tracking
  • Inventory management
  • Profit analysis

Because Excel is versatile, learning it benefits almost everyone.


Advanced Excel Skills Are Highly Valuable

Basic Excel knowledge is good, but advanced Excel skills can make you even more valuable to employers.

Some important advanced Excel features include:

  • Pivot Tables
  • VLOOKUP & HLOOKUP
  • INDEX & MATCH
  • IF formulas
  • Data Validation
  • Conditional Formatting
  • Dashboards
  • Macros & Automation

Professionals with advanced Excel knowledge are often considered more productive and efficient.


Excel Skills Help During Interviews

Many companies conduct practical Excel tests during recruitment.

Candidates may be asked to:

  • Create reports
  • Use formulas
  • Analyze data
  • Organize spreadsheets

If you already know Excel, you can perform confidently during interviews.

This increases your chances of getting selected.
